Real-World Supply Chain Collaboration at Work

Successful supply chain operation hinges on seamless collaboration between various stakeholders. A prime illustration is the automotive market, where manufacturers collaborate closely with suppliers to ensure timely delivery of crucial components. This degree of coordination helps mitigate risks, optimize stock, and ultimately deliver vehicles to customers more efficiently. Furthermore, collaborative platforms allow for real-time visibility of shipments, enabling proactive issue resolution.

  • Businesses are increasingly leveraging technology like blockchain to strengthen transparency and trust within their supply chains.
  • Through sharing data and insights, partners can detect potential bottlenecks and together find solutions.
  • In Conclusion, real-world supply chain collaboration leads to a more sustainable ecosystem that benefits all members.

Cultivating Trust and Transparency: Key Principles of Supply Chain Collaboration

In today's dynamic global marketplace, effective supply chain collaboration is crucial for organizations to thrive. A cornerstone of successful collaboration lies in establishing a foundation of trust and transparency among all stakeholders. This involves open dialogue, common goals, and a commitment to responsible practices. By implementing these principles, supply chains can become more robust, ultimately leading to improved efficiency, lowered costs, and enhanced customer satisfaction.

Transparency in supply chains means providing clear and accurate data about product origins, manufacturing processes, and delivery schedules. This allows all members to make sound decisions and identify potential issues in advance. Trust, on the other hand, is built through dependability, integrity, and a willingness to collaborate. When partners trust each other, they are more likely to provide valuable knowledge and work jointly to tackle challenges.
